Uploaded on Jul 22, 2022
Python is one of the most widely used programming languages for businesses. Discover the uses of Python. Learn about fundamental data structures like dictionaries, collections, and lists. learning the key ideas, such as loops and decision-making.
Top 10 Ways to Become an Expert Python Developer
Top 8 Methods for Becoming an Expert
Python Developer
What to Learn in Python
● Python is one of the most widely used programming languages for
businesses.
● Discover the uses of Python.
● Learn about fundamental data structures like dictionaries, collections,
and lists.
● learning the key ideas, such as loops and decision-making.
● Discover how to build a virtual setting.
● Please select Functions and Recurrence.
● Class, method, inheritance, and overloading are good places to start
when learning about object-oriented content.
● Learn about complex subjects including networking, XML
processing, and multiprocessing.
● Python can be used to make GUIs.
Frameworks
Every developer agrees that knowing every aspect of a programming language is
essential to mastery. Yes, that may be somewhat accurate, but there is no need to
master all of Python's constructs first.
Python Libraries
Libraries are collections of code that programmers can reuse when developing new
programs.
● This eliminates the need to spend time and effort developing code base
systems from the ground up.
● Consider how much code is in the library to construct applications like
data science, machine learning, and data visualization, among other
things.
● Your objective is to become acquainted with the various codes
available, properly investigate them, and begin applying them.
The number of projects in the Python library can also be used to estimate the size of
the Python community. So, interact with them to make the meeting worthwhile.
Develop Your GitHub Repository
Whe●n yGoiuv ea pypoluy rf orre pa ojosbit oarsy a a P ybtrhieofn, dceavtcehloyp er, your GitHub repository
dou●bleCns ahamos oyeso.eu rr e rpeosusmitoer.y visibility.
● Click Create repository.
Develop Your Skills by Working on Python Projects
Working on Python projects is a solid way to improve your Python programming
skills.
Publish a website
It may seem obvious, but building a website from scratch with a framework like
Django or Flask is a great way to learn Python.
Create a web service.
You should have experience in developing web services, and frameworks like
Falcon or Flask would be very useful.
Get information from the internet
Python is a very popular tool for getting data, and it has some great modules that
make your life a lot easier.
Web page scraping Python can be used with tools like BeautifulSoup to scrape
websites.
● Simulated rolling of dice.
● Guessing numbers.
● Block websites.
Write Readable Code
Although obvious, it should be mentioned. Make sure your code is clear and
understandable to others when you write it.
● Indentation
● spaces and tabs
● The longest line possible
● Break the lines
● Without lines
● Encryption for source files
● Quotes in lines
● Expressions with white spaces
● trailing commas
● Naming conventions
What it takes to become a Python Programmer
To become one, you must first have a good understanding of the basic ideas of
Python.
● OOPs concepts
● Variables and data types
● File handling concepts
● Exception Handling
● Generators
● Iterators
Apart from these, you should be familiar with web architecture. A skilled
Python web developer should be familiar with these two web frameworks,
including Django and Flask.
● Django is a high-level Python web framework with a straightforward,
functional architecture.
● Flask, on the other hand, is one of the most popular Python micro-
web frameworks.
● You should also be familiar with front-end technologies like HTML,
CSS, and JavaScript.
Develop a Portfolio of Python Projects
As you gain language proficiency, build a portfolio of Python-based projects to
highlight your accomplishments.
● Try your hand at jobs like computer file systems, digital collection
curation, or neural network training.
● Use graphs, bar charts, and other visualizations to illustrate your data and
projects.
● Add your work to a portfolio that includes a website such as Github.
● Enroll in a Python programming class and include your final project and
coursework in your portfolio.
Some examples of tasks are organizing data on your computer, keeping track of
your digital collections, or building a neural network.
Also, you get a credential that sets you apart from the competition and can
be linked to better Python developer earnings.
● Sort the files on your computer.
● Maintain an inventory of your digital holdings.
● As a static website, host your résumé.
● Construct dynamic webpages
What Is Python Programming Used For
Python is often used to create applications and websites, automate time-consuming
operations, and analyze and present data.
One of the most popular programming languages, Python was created in 1991 by
Guido von Rossum with the goal of helping programmers write clear,
understandable code.
● Web and software development
● Computing with numbers and science
● instructing beginners and experts in programming
● Data science and artificial intelligence
● building online storefronts
Python Developer Responsibilities
A typical Python developer generates designs, writes code, and publishes
applications.
The individual is frequently required to debug codes and build systems that can be
integrated. A Python developer's tasks and responsibilities are determined by job
description, industry or vertical, and work experience, even if these are accurate.
● Designing, developing, and debugging programs and applications
● Data collection and analysis
● Scripting and Automation
● Web design and development
● Application development and implementation
● Developing database structures to support business processes
● Integrating user interface components with server-side logic
What is the demand for Python?
Every coder has a favorite language that they are most comfortable using.
Python should be adopted by companies like Google, Netflix, Spotify, and Pinterest
for good reason.
● In contrast to Ruby, Python is renowned for its technicality and simplicity.
● Java does not behave like Python, which allows the runtime and code
structure to be changed after compilation.
● Python provides more readability and versatility when compared to PHP.
● Startups favor Python because of its low cost of development.
● In contrast to C, Python has a shaky historical background but is rapidly
evolving into one of the strongest languages available.
Comments